Output 673eabddcc4ec8284711824d283504fc21caf0e9adbf577defb650f5e9cc1b41:0

value
1381258
script pubkey
OP_0 OP_PUSHBYTES_20 abccd653d124249f650b0d362b777a06c9499c8e
address
bc1q40xdv573ysjf7egtp5mzkam6qmy5n8ywufw86j
transaction
673eabddcc4ec8284711824d283504fc21caf0e9adbf577defb650f5e9cc1b41